Another FIA meeting on Ukraine
An
FIA spokesman has confirmed to several journalists that the FIA will meet on Tuesday to further discuss the situation in Ukraine. Last Thursday, Ukraine was invaded by Russian President Vladimir Putin. The FIA already decided the following day not to allow the
Russian Grand Prix to take place in September under these circumstances. The football associations, FIFA and UEFA, agreed on Monday to exclude Russian teams from international football. They are also cancelling their sponsorship of Gazprom.
The
Haas F1 team also took swift action during winter testing in Barcelona by removing the Russian main sponsor Uralkali from the car. The seat of Russian driver
Nikita Mazepin is in jeopardy as a result. Should the World Motor Sport Council take the same decision as UEFA and FIFA, Mazepin's season is almost certainly over. The statement from the FIA spokesperson reads:
“Tomorrow there will be an extraordinary meeting in the WMSC to discuss matters related to the ongoing crisis in Ukraine. Further updates will follow after the meeting.”
